Nature Lover's Escape: Himachal Pradesh, Rajasthan, Uttarakhand

Thursday, September 28: Shimla, Himachal Pradesh

Start your journey by arriving in Shimla, the capital of Himachal Pradesh. In the morning, explore the lush greenery of the city by visiting the Shimla Ridge and Mall Road. Enjoy the panoramic views of the surrounding mountains from the Ridge and indulge in some shopping on Mall Road. In the afternoon, visit the Jakhu Temple, located on Jakhu Hill, and admire the serene atmosphere. As the evening approaches, take a leisurely walk along the Chadwick Falls and immerse yourself in the tranquil surroundings.

  • Shimla Ridge and Mall Road: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 3 hours
  • Jakhu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2 hours
  • Chadwick Falls: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
Friday, September 29: Udaipur, Rajasthan

Embark on a journey to Udaipur, the "City of Lakes" in Rajasthan. Start your day by visiting the picturesque Lake Pichola in the morning. Take a boat ride to enjoy the scenic beauty and visit the famous Jag Mandir Palace located on an island in the lake. In the afternoon, explore the City Palace, a magnificent palace complex offering stunning views of the city. End your day by watching a traditional Rajasthani cultural show at the Bagore Ki Haveli Museum, showcasing folk dance and music.

  • Lake Pichola: Cost - Boat ride estimated at INR 400, Time Spent - 2 hours
  • Jag Mandir Palace: Cost - INR 450 for entry, Time Spent - 1 hour
  • City Palace: Cost - INR 300 for entry, Time Spent - 3 hours
  • Bagore Ki Haveli Museum: Cost - INR 100 for entry, Time Spent - 2 hours
Saturday, September 30: Rishikesh, Uttarakhand

Head to the spiritual town of Rishikesh in Uttarakhand. Begin your morning by visiting the iconic Laxman Jhula, a suspension bridge over the River Ganges. Take a peaceful stroll and enjoy the scenic views of the river and surrounding hills. In the afternoon, explore the ashrams and temples in the area, such as the Beatles Ashram and the Triveni Ghat. As the evening sets in, witness the mesmerizing Ganga Aarti ceremony, a spiritual ritual performed at the Parmarth Niketan Ashram.

  • Laxman Jhula: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2 hours
  • Beatles Ashram: Cost - INR 150 for entry, Time Spent - 1 hour
  • Triveni Ghat: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
  • Ganga Aarti at Parmarth Niketan Ashram: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
Sunday, October 1: Mussoorie, Uttarakhand

Travel to the charming hill station of Mussoorie, also known as the "Queen of Hills." Start your day by visiting Kempty Falls, a popular tourist spot, and enjoy the refreshing cascades amidst lush green surroundings. In the afternoon, explore the Mall Road, an iconic shopping street offering stunning views of the valley. Visit the Gun Hill viewpoint via cable car for breathtaking panoramic views. As the evening approaches, take a leisurely walk along the Camel's Back Road and witness a beautiful sunset.

  • Kempty Falls: Cost - INR 150 for entry, Time Spent - 2 hours
  • Mall Road: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2 hours
  • Gun Hill: Cost - Cable car ride estimated at INR 100, Time Spent - 1 hour
  • Camel's Back Road: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
Monday, October 2: Jaipur, Rajasthan

Conclude your trip in the vibrant city of Jaipur, the capital of Rajasthan. Begin your morning by visiting the majestic Amer Fort, located on a hilltop. Explore the grandeur of the fort and enjoy the panoramic views of the surrounding hills. In the afternoon, visit the City Palace, home to beautiful palaces and museums showcasing Rajasthani art and culture. End your day by witnessing the stunning sunset at the Nahargarh Fort, offering breathtaking views of the city.

  • Amer Fort: Cost - INR 500 for entry, Time Spent - 3 hours
  • City Palace: Cost - INR 500 for entry, Time Spent - 2 hours
  • Nahargarh Fort: Cost - INR 200 for entry, Time Spent - 2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For nature lovers seeking off the beaten path attractions, Himachal Pradesh offers the serene landscapes of Spiti Valley, perfect for trekking and wildlife spotting. In Rajasthan, explore the Keoladeo National Park in Bharatpur, a haven for birdwatchers. Uttarakhand's hidden gem is the Valley of Flowers National Park, a UNESCO World Heritage Site famous for its blooming alpine flowers.
